BK08 LHX is a 2008 Mercedes-benz Cls in Gold with a 2,987c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 69.2%.
Across all 2008 Mercedes-benz Cls models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.5% with a typical mileage of 82,334 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mercedes-benz Cls f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 8,450 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BK08 LHX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mercedes-benz Cls typ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 18 years old, this Mercedes-benz Cls is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
